Biography
Rick Yune (born Richard Yun; August 22, 1971) is a Korean American actor, screenwriter, producer, and martial artist. He is the older brother of actor Karl Yune. His best known roles are as Master Clive Lee in Alita: Battle Angel, Kaidu Khan in Netflix's series Marco Polo, Kang in Olympus Has Fallen, Zen Yi the X-Blade in The Man with the Iron Fists, Zao in the James Bond movie Die Another Day, and Johnny Tran in The Fast and the Furious. He practices many forms of martial arts, having reached Olympic standard in Taekwondo and being a serious contender for the US team when he was 19. He changed the spelling of his last name from "Yun" to "Yune" for Screen Actors Guild (SAG) purposes. He was voted one of People magazine's Sexiest Men in 2002.
